No, there is no direct bus from New Malden to Charlton. However, there are services departing from St Joseph's Church and arriving at Charlton Village via Westminster Station / Parliament Square.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 58m.
No, there is no direct train from New Malden to Charlton. However, there are services departing from New Malden and arriving at Charlton via Waterloo station and London Bridge.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 51 min.
The distance between New Malden and Charlton is 18 miles. The road distance is 16.3 miles.
